moe666 Posted August 16, 2011 Share Posted August 16, 2011 (edited) You may want to post in the Chiang mai forum. It is easy transportation around Chiang Mai nothing is that far away. You may want to expand your area into the old city as lots of accomadation ther and more action during the day as well and at night. You can make one or two trips at night to night market and you have seem it. There is also a Sat. market on Waulai road and a Sunday market on the mainrd in old city. Check out Chiang mai Gate hotel and also Smith Residence both in the area of Chiang mai Gate on the southside of Old City. They both have website. Chiang mai Gate furnishes a bus to night market. or tuk-tuk avaliable Edited August 16, 2011 by moe666 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Alcat Posted August 21, 2011 Share Posted August 21, 2011 We always stay at Lai Thai guesthouse. It is very quiet, has a lovely big pool which is always clean. Is close to the Muay Thai stadium, About 10 minutes walk and a nice 15 mins to the night market. There is a huge Sunday market next to the Muay Thai stadium. They will pick you up at the airport for free. There is an excellent dentist just down the road. Get your teeth cleaned for about 400 baht. The rooms are Average but so is the price. Excellent value.
